Find a Lawyer in Kobenhavn NVAbout State, Local, and Municipal Law in Kobenhavn NV, Denmark
State, local, and municipal law in Kobenhavn NV, Denmark, forms the foundation of the legal framework that governs public administration and local government operations. These laws determine how local authorities function and manage various aspects of public life, such as zoning, public services, taxation, and more. The legal framework ensures that the municipal council adheres to national standards while addressing local issues effectively. Adherence to these laws is essential for maintaining order and quality of life for residents.

Local Laws Overview
In Kobenhavn NV, several local laws and regulations are significant in the realm of state, local, and municipal law:
- Zoning Regulations: These determine land use categories, such as residential, commercial, or industrial, and affect development permissions.
- Building Codes: These ensure structures comply with safety, health, and environmental standards.
- The Municipal Budget: This governs the allocation of funds for public services and infrastructure projects.
- Public Safety Ordinances: Regulations that address noise levels, public gatherings, and other community safety issues.
- Local Government Authority: The scope of power and responsibilities held by the municipal council and various local government bodies.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is municipal law?
Municipal law refers to the regulations that govern a municipality, including local government operations, zoning laws, and community services.
How do zoning laws affect property development?
Zoning laws dictate what activities can take place on a property, such as residential, commercial, or industrial use, thereby influencing property development.
What should I do if I receive a municipal violation notice?
You should review the notice carefully, understand the alleged violation, and consider consulting a lawyer to explore your options.
How can I apply for a building permit in Kobenhavn NV?
Building permits are processed by the local municipal authority. It's advisable to check their specific requirements and potentially seek legal guidance if necessary.
What steps should I take if I have a dispute with local authorities?
Try to resolve the matter directly with the municipal office. If unresolved, consider mediation or legal action with the help of a lawyer.
Can local laws differ from national laws?
Yes, local laws can differ but must align with the overarching framework and authority provided by national laws.
Where can I find more information about local taxes?
The municipality's official website often provides comprehensive resources on local taxation, including rates and payment processes.
What are my rights regarding public services?
Residents have the right to access public services; however, specific rights and obligations depend on local regulations and contracts.
How are decisions made in the municipal council?
The municipal council, elected by local citizens, makes decisions through meetings and votes, reflecting the community's needs and priorities.
How can I participate in local government?
Residents can attend council meetings, vote in local elections, and engage in public consultations to participate in local government decisions.
